Navigating the Asia-Pacific Climate-Cyber Polycrisis: A Resilience Mandate

The Asia-Pacific region is facing a compounding 'polycrisis' where climate-driven disasters and cybersecurity vulnerabilities intersect to threaten regional stability. As digital infrastructure expands across disaster-prone zones, policymakers are urged to integrate environmental and digital resilience into unified regulatory frameworks.
